What Should You Look for in Late Season Archery Clothing?
When selecting late season archery clothing, it’s essential to prioritize warmth, concealment, and mobility.
- Insulation: Look for clothing that offers adequate insulation to keep you warm in cold conditions. Materials like down or synthetic insulation are effective at trapping body heat while remaining lightweight.
- Waterproofing: Choose garments with waterproof or water-resistant features to protect against rain or snow. This ensures that you stay dry and comfortable, which is crucial for maintaining focus during long hours in the field.
- Camouflage Pattern: Select clothing with an effective camouflage pattern that matches the late season environment. This enhances your ability to blend into the surroundings, making it less likely for game to detect your presence.
- Breathability: Ensure that the fabric is breathable to allow moisture and sweat to escape, preventing overheating during physical activity. Look for clothing with ventilation features or moisture-wicking properties to stay dry and comfortable.
- Layering Capability: Opt for clothing designed for layering, which allows you to adjust your insulation based on temperature changes. Base layers, mid-layers, and outer shells should work together to provide versatility and adaptability throughout the day.
- Quiet Fabric: Consider materials that are silent when moving, as noise can alert game to your presence. Fabrics specifically designed for hunting often incorporate technology to minimize sound, enhancing your stealth.
- Fit and Mobility: Look for a good fit that allows for freedom of movement, especially in the shoulders and arms. A comfortable fit ensures that you can draw your bow without restriction and maintain your focus on the hunt.
How Important Is Insulation in Selecting Late Season Archery Gear?
Insulation plays a critical role in selecting the best late season archery clothing, as it directly impacts comfort, performance, and effectiveness in cold weather conditions.
- Layered Insulation: Layering allows for flexibility in adjusting to changing temperatures and activity levels. Base layers wick moisture away from the body, while mid-layers trap heat, and outer layers protect against wind and moisture, ensuring optimal warmth without bulk.
- Material Quality: The choice of insulation material, such as down or synthetic fibers, affects warmth retention and weight. Down insulation is known for its excellent warmth-to-weight ratio, but it loses its insulating properties when wet, whereas synthetic materials perform better in damp conditions but may be bulkier.
- Breathability: Proper insulation must balance warmth with breathability to prevent overheating and moisture buildup. Fabrics that offer ventilation features help regulate temperature, allowing archers to stay comfortable during periods of high activity, such as drawing a bow or moving through the woods.
- Fit and Mobility: Insulated clothing should provide a snug yet flexible fit to allow for a full range of motion while drawing a bow. Bulky clothing can restrict movement, making it difficult to aim and shoot accurately, so selecting gear with articulated joints and ergonomic designs is essential.
- Wind and Water Resistance: In late season conditions, insulation should be complemented by windproof and waterproof features to shield against harsh elements. Clothing with these characteristics helps maintain core body temperature and prevents the insulation from becoming ineffective due to moisture exposure.
Why Is Waterproofing Essential for Late Season Hunting?
Waterproofing is essential for late season hunting because it protects hunters from the harsh elements, particularly rain and snow, which can lead to discomfort and decreased effectiveness in the field.
According to a study by the National Park Service, exposure to cold and wet conditions can significantly impair a person’s ability to perform tasks effectively, as even mild hypothermia can set in quickly when clothing becomes saturated. This can be particularly detrimental for hunters who need to remain alert and focused to ensure successful hunting experiences.
The underlying mechanism involves the body’s thermoregulation process. When clothing is not waterproof, moisture can seep in, leading to heat loss through evaporation and conduction. As the body loses heat, it expends more energy to maintain its core temperature, which can result in fatigue and decreased mobility. Furthermore, wet clothing can lead to skin irritation and chafing, further compounding the discomfort and distraction for hunters. Thus, waterproof clothing is not just a luxury but a necessity for maintaining performance and safety during late-season hunts.
How Does Camouflage Influence Late Season Archery Success?
Camouflage plays a critical role in enhancing late season archery success by helping hunters blend into their environments, thereby reducing detection by deer and other game.
- Pattern Selection: The choice of camouflage pattern is essential for effective concealment during late season hunts.
- Material and Insulation: The right materials not only aid in camouflage but also provide necessary insulation against cold temperatures.
- Layering System: A proper layering system allows for adaptability to changing weather conditions while maintaining stealth.
- Texture and Finish: The texture and finish of camouflage clothing can significantly impact how well a hunter blends into their surroundings.
Pattern Selection: The effectiveness of camouflage is highly dependent on the patterns used, which should mimic the late season landscape, including bare trees, fallen leaves, and other natural elements. Patterns that feature a mix of colors and shapes can help disrupt the outline of the hunter’s body, making it more difficult for game to detect movement.
Material and Insulation: In late season, temperatures can drop significantly, so it’s crucial to select clothing made from materials that provide warmth without sacrificing mobility. Insulated fabrics not only keep the hunter warm but can also be designed to maintain a low profile, ensuring that any noise from movement is minimized while still providing effective camouflage.
Layering System: A layering system is vital for regulating body temperature during late season hunts, allowing hunters to add or remove layers as conditions change. Base layers wick moisture away from the skin, mid-layers provide insulation, and outer layers offer protection from the elements while maintaining camouflage effectiveness.
Texture and Finish: The texture of the clothing can affect how light interacts with the surface, which is important for staying concealed. Matte finishes are preferable to shiny materials that can reflect sunlight and draw attention, while textures that mimic natural surroundings can further enhance the effectiveness of the camouflage.
What Are the Best Brands for Late Season Archery Clothing?
The best brands for late season archery clothing combine warmth, comfort, and functionality to enhance performance during colder months.
- Sitka Gear: Known for its high-performance outdoor clothing, Sitka Gear offers late season archery apparel designed with advanced insulation and moisture-wicking properties. Their gear often features Gore-Tex technology for waterproofing while maintaining breathability, making it ideal for unpredictable late fall weather.
- Under Armour: Under Armour is renowned for its innovative fabrics and athletic fit, which are perfect for archers who need flexibility and warmth. Their late season line includes thermal layers and wind-resistant outerwear that keep hunters comfortable while allowing for a full range of motion.
- First Lite: Specializing in hunting apparel, First Lite emphasizes the use of merino wool, which offers excellent insulation and odor control. Their late season options are designed to keep you warm without bulk, making them suitable for long hours in the stand.
- Kuiu: Kuiu focuses on lightweight and technical clothing that excels in late season conditions. Their layering system allows hunters to adjust their clothing based on activity level and temperature, ensuring optimal comfort and performance.
- Badlands: Badlands is known for its durable and functional hunting gear, and their late season clothing is no exception. Their products often feature innovative materials that provide warmth and protection against the elements, along with ample pocket space for gear organization.

How Can Layering Improve Your Late Season Archery Experience?
Layering is essential for improving comfort and effectiveness in late season archery.
- Base Layer: A moisture-wicking base layer is crucial for keeping sweat away from the skin, which helps regulate body temperature and prevents chills. Look for materials like merino wool or synthetic fabrics that offer insulation without bulk.
- Mid Layer: The mid layer provides additional insulation and helps trap heat. Fleece or down options are excellent choices, as they are lightweight yet effective at providing warmth while still allowing for a full range of motion essential for drawing a bow.
- Outer Layer: An outer layer protects against wind, rain, and snow while also providing camouflage. Look for breathable and waterproof materials that offer adequate protection without compromising mobility, as being silent and stealthy is critical in archery hunting.
- Insulated Accessories: Accessories such as gloves, hats, and neck gaiters are important to keep extremities warm. Choose insulated options that maintain dexterity in your fingers for easy handling of equipment and ensure comfort without hindering your shooting performance.
- Footwear: Proper footwear is vital for warmth and comfort during long sits. Insulated and waterproof boots will help keep your feet dry and warm, while also providing traction for navigating various terrains commonly found in late season hunting environments.

Why Is Breathability Important While Layering for Hunting?
Breathability is important while layering for hunting because it helps regulate body temperature and moisture levels, which are crucial for comfort and performance in cold weather conditions.
According to a study published in the Journal of Sports Sciences, effective moisture management is essential for maintaining thermal comfort during physical activities. When hunting in late-season conditions, hunters are often subjected to a combination of cold temperatures and physical exertion, which can lead to sweating. If the moisture generated by the body is not effectively wicked away, it can lead to chilling as the sweat cools, significantly impacting a hunter’s ability to remain warm and focused.
The underlying mechanism behind breathability in hunting layers lies in the fabric technology used in the best late season archery clothing. Breathable fabrics allow moisture vapor to escape while preventing external elements like wind and water from penetrating the layers. This balance is crucial; if the outer layer is not breathable, moisture accumulates inside, leading to a damp environment that can cause discomfort and increased heat loss. According to the Outdoor Industry Association, layering systems that incorporate breathable materials not only enhance comfort but also extend the time hunters can remain active in the field without succumbing to the adverse effects of cold and dampness.
